Nouvions Wind Farm is a 43.6MW onshore wind power project. It is planned in Hauts-de-France, France. According to GlobalData, who tracks and profiles over 170,000 power plants worldwide, the project is currently at the under construction stage. It will be developed in a single phase. Description

The project is being developed by Parc Eolien Nordex LXIV and RWE Renewables. The project is currently owned by RWE Renewables with a stake of 100%.

The project is expected to supply enough clean energy to power 22,700 households. The project cost is expected to be around $74.03m.

The project will have 114m high towers.

Contractors involved

Nordex will be the turbine supplier for the wind power project. The company is expected to provide 11 units of N149/3960 TS 105 turbines.

Nordex is expected to perform operations and maintenance for the wind power project for a period of 5 years.
